Está en la página 1de 2

Tema 3: Dispositivos comunes en los controladores: STM32

1) Timers / Watchdog

Tipos de Timers

 TIM1: control avanzado, usado principalmente para PWM. 4 canales de captura y


comparación 16 bits.
 TIM de propósito general. TIM4 y TIM14-17. TIM3 4 canales de 16 bits.
 TIM básico: TIM 6 y 7: Timers básicos para control del tiempo.
 Ejemplo:
- TIM2/3: timers de propósito general de 16 bits de cuenta up, down, up/down, de 4
canales de captura de señales de entrada y comparación, genera señal pwm a la
salida

Tipos de Watchdog

 Watchdog independiente
 Watchdog de sistema
 SysTick

2) Inter integrated circuit (I2C)

3) ADCs

Convertidor analógico digital con el que cuenta el microcontrolador. SAR registro de


aproximaciones sucesivas.

4) Serial Peripheral Interface (SPI)

Se usa para la comunicación serie síncrona entre un host (maestro) y un dispositivo esclavo.
Cuenta con tres líneas: una de reloj y dos de datos (intercambio de información entre master-
slave)
Master input slave output
MISO
Master output slave input
MOSI
5) Digital to Analogic Converter (DAC)

 Característica:
- Utilizado para controlar actuadores analógicos (ej. motor paso a paso)
- Los TIM6 y TIM7 se utilizan para disparar la conversión periódica

6) USART (Universal Sync Async Receiver Transmiter)

Tipo de comunicación utilizado para dispositivos duales, es decir, capaces de recibir y


transmitir datos o información. Intercambio de datos a alta velocidad y flexibilidad.

7) Unidad de CRC (Comprobación de redundancia cíclica)

Código de detección de errores de datos mediante la división de un número y obteniendo su


cociente y resto.

8) GPIO (General Purpuse Input/Output)

Pin genérico de entrada o salida por el que el usuario lo controla (programar).

También podría gustarte